Ok Ive got a little story.
Last week i had stage 3 of a root canal done. And lucky me a file broke off in the canal. I was told this might not matter its not common, but can happen. So they finished it off not being able to remove the file and told me if i have problems i would have to get a apicoectomy done (cutting through the gum)
All was well untill i felt a bit of pressure on my jaw and tender tooth early this week. On monday arvo about 5:30pm i decided to have a home brew within 3 mins, a glass down I started getting incredible pain in my tooth a jaw i droped everything a rolled up into a ball.
I never felt such pain in all my life.. Later i got antibiotics and the dentist said it's infected. From then on i was taking nurofen plus every 4-5 hours keep it at bay.
So tuesday 5:30pm decided to have a brew. same thing happens aghh. and agian tonight, and not untill tonight am i convinced that my beer is aggravating this tooth in the most intense and sudden way. All week Ive been drinking different drinks that are colder/hotter and nothing happens. it only the beer that sends it wild.
i was wondering does anyone know why??
